Common Issues and Errors Related to libAndyEGL.dll
DLL files often play a critical role in system operations. Despite their importance, these files can sometimes source system errors. Below we consider some of the most frequently encountered faults associated with DLL files.
- LibAndyEGL.dll Access Violation: This indicates a process tried to access or modify a memory location related to libAndyEGL.dll that it isn't allowed to. This is often a sign of problems with the software using the DLL, such as bugs or corruption.
- LibAndyEGL.dll is either not designed to run on Windows or it contains an error: This error typically signifies that the DLL file may be incompatible with your version of Windows, or it's corrupted. It can also occur if you're trying to run a DLL file meant for a different system architecture (for instance, a 64-bit DLL on a 32-bit system).
- Cannot register libAndyEGL.dll: The message means that the operating system failed to register the DLL file. This can happen if there are file permission issues, if the DLL file is missing or misplaced, or if there's an issue with the Registry.
- LibAndyEGL.dll not found: This error message suggests that the DLL file required for a certain operation or program is not present in your system. It may have been unintentionally removed during a software update or system cleanup.
- LibAndyEGL.dll could not be loaded: This error signifies that the system encountered an issue while trying to load the DLL file. Possible reasons include the DLL being missing, the presence of an outdated version, or conflicts with other DLL files in the system.

Run the Windows Memory Diagnostic Tool
How to run a Windows Memory Diagnostic test. If the libAndyEGL.dll error is related to memory issues it should resolve the problem.
-
Press the Windows key.
-
Type
Windows Memory Diagnosticin the search bar and press Enter.
-
In the Windows Memory Diagnostic window, click on Restart now and check for problems (recommended).
-
Your computer will restart and the memory diagnostic will run automatically. It might take some time.
-
After the diagnostic, your computer will restart again. You can check the results in the notification area on your desktop.
